Transaction 1403b418fbb0f62bf39bb58862f5e6f84bb9975db20ac09e828d441547a0e09a

3 Input
2 Outputs
  • 1403b418fbb0f62bf39bb58862f5e6f84bb9975db20ac09e828d441547a0e09a:0
  • value  3045071
    address  32QJokSk7ziBPGcbTxoqSDjnZBwtae4hFR
  • 1403b418fbb0f62bf39bb58862f5e6f84bb9975db20ac09e828d441547a0e09a:1
  • value  1140611
    address  bc1qs24f3wred5uc6zw2fpy70f6frnc7lhnqldajhv